Man indicted on solicitation charge

A Cannon Air Force Base air traffic controller was indicted Friday on charges of child solicitation by electronic device.


Michael Lee Harvey, 19, was arrested Feb. 10 in Clovis after traveling to engage in sexual activity with a 13-year-old girl he met in an Internet chat room, according to a release from the Curry County Sheriff’s Department.


The girl was fictitious, the release said, with the online profile created and maintained by deputies at the sheriff’s department.


Harvey was arrested as he was attempting to enter the house, where he was informed the girl would be, with her parents asleep at the home, according to the release.


Cannon’s Office of Special Investigation aided in the investigation, collecting evidence from his residence, according to the release.


Harvey had been at Cannon for two days before his arrest, according to the release. Cannon was his first assignment.


If convicted, Harvey faces up to 18 months and fines up to $5,000.
